0

我正在为一项任务开发一个交互式网页。我在数据库表中有所需的信息,单击不同的页面元素会查询数据库并显示该特定选择的相关信息。但是,页面会在显示附加信息之前刷新。有没有一种解决方案,可以从数据库中查询信息并显示在页面上,而不需要刷新页面?

对于上下文,或者如果我的解释不够好,这是我正在进行的工作:(对不起网址)

移除

谢谢。

编辑:,抱歉 - 添加代码

    <?php
    while($row=mysql_fetch_array($query_result))
    {?>
        <tr id="tablerow" class="output" onclick="document.location.href=page.php?id=<?php echo $row['item_id'];?>'" style="cursor:pointer">
            <a href="elements.php?id=<?php echo $row['item_id'];?>">
            <td><?php echo $row['field1']; ?></td>
            <td><?php echo $row['field2']; ?></td>
            <td><?php echo $row['field3'];?></td>
            <td><?php echo $row['field4']; ?></td>
            <td><?php echo $row['field5']; ?></td>
            <td><?php echo $row['field6']; ?></td>
            </a>
        </tr>
        <script>
            document.getElementById('id_val').style.background="#d3d3d3";
        </script>
    <?php }
    ?>
4

2 回答 2

0

因为您正在使用链接。使用 jquery 页面加载器: http: //api.jquerymobile.com/loader/

于 2013-09-06T04:36:05.263 回答
0

对于这样的用例,我强烈推荐使用meteor.com。

我已经使用 PHP/MySQL 多年,也使用了流星大约一年。像这样的事情在流星上花费的时间要少得多(而且,我认为,学习曲线不像原始 AJAX 那样陡峭)。

当然,我相信其他人也会有他们的意见。

我的两分钱。

于 2013-09-06T04:36:07.087 回答